abivan (03.04.2015 12:51, просмотров: 125) ответил PeterD на В IAR-e путаюсь передать структуру в функцию.
поставьте слово struct перед round_buff_ unsigned short int round_buff_wr_rd (round_buff_ *chn_adcX, unsigned short int data, STATE_FIFO state )
а еще лучше через typedef
typedef struct {
unsigned short int buff[16];
unsigned char p_wr;
unsigned char p_rd;
unsigned char num_write_rd;
}round_buff_t;
round_buff_t chn_adc0,chn_adc1;
unsigned short int round_buff_wr_rd (round_buff_t *chn_adcX, unsigned short int data, STATE_FIFO state );